回答
你需要一個HTML頁面來加載一個JS文件。
通常使用文本編輯器來創建源文件(如JavaScript)。我使用了IntelliStudio支持JavaScript的VisualStudio,但任何其他編輯器都會這樣做(Windows上的vim或notepad都可以)。
要自行運行JavaScript,您需要可以做到的事情。即在Windows上,您可以使用CScript script.js
命令直接從控制檯運行腳本。在Windows和其他操作系統上運行JavaScript還有其他方法。
瀏覽器(如Chrome瀏覽器)不會自行運行JavaScript,只能作爲頁面或擴展的一部分。目前還不清楚瀏覽器本身會如何處理JavaScript。
謝謝。我將編寫包含JavaScript函數的HTML文件,然後在Chrome中加載HTML文件以運行這些函數。 – chaohuang 2012-03-16 05:12:10
關於內置於Windows的JS引擎非常酷! – 2014-10-16 03:32:38
你不需要必然需要有一個HTML頁面。打開Chrome,按Ctrl+Shift+j
並打開JavaScript控制檯,您可以在其中編寫和測試代碼。
你應該在文件中寫:
<script>
//write your JavaScript code here
</script>
保存它與.html擴展名並用瀏覽器打開。
例如:
// this is test.html
<script>
alert("Hello");
var a = 5;
function incr(arg){
arg++;
return arg;
}
alert(a);
</script>
打開一個基本的文本編輯器,然後輸入你的HTML。將其另存爲.html 如果您在地址欄中輸入file:/// C:/,您可以導航到您選擇的文件並運行它。 如果要打開file:///中服務器類型的文件,而不是C:/服務器的首字母后跟:/。
試試這個:
1. https://nodejs.org/
2.將(在Mac上或終端)你的JavaScript代碼安裝Node.js的到.js文件(例如,someCode.js)
3.打開CMD殼並使用節點的Read-EVAL-打印循環(REPL)來執行這樣的someCode.js:
>節點someCode.js
希望這有助於!
- 1. 有沒有辦法在運行中創建子類?
- 2. 有沒有辦法在javascript中換行?
- 3. 有沒有辦法運行Chrome擴展程序而不點擊?
- 4. 有沒有辦法在.NET 3.5中運行時動態創建一個對象?
- 5. 有沒有辦法在XBL中創建私有方法?
- 6. 有沒有辦法在html和javascript或jQuery中創建登錄系統?
- 7. 有沒有辦法運行NPM安裝
- 8. 有沒有辦法脫機運行Trac?
- 9. 有沒有辦法在執行JavaScript時回顯每一行JavaScript?
- 10. 有沒有辦法在Excel宏中運行異步方法?
- 11. 有沒有辦法在運行時加載類jar和包?
- 12. 有沒有辦法從JavaScript運行R代碼?
- 13. 有沒有辦法強制javascript函數先運行
- 14. 有沒有辦法阻止window.history.forward後運行額外的JavaScript?
- 15. 有沒有辦法在PHP中從流中重新創建PDF?
- 16. 有沒有辦法控制Chrome GC?
- 17. 有沒有辦法'測試運行'螞蟻構建?
- 18. 有沒有辦法在IResultListener方法之前運行@after方法?
- 19. 水貂和Behat:有沒有辦法在後臺啓動硒(Chrome)?
- 20. 有沒有什麼辦法可以在windows phone中創建pdf
- 21. Julia makedir dir.create有沒有辦法在Julia中創建目錄?
- 22. 有沒有辦法在SSRS 2008中自動創建訂閱?
- 23. 有沒有辦法在Django模型中創建依賴字段?
- 24. 有沒有辦法在Mercurial中創建外部鏈接
- 25. 有沒有辦法在python中動態創建/修改函數
- 26. 有沒有辦法在SQL Server中創建自己的@@變量?
- 27. 有沒有辦法在asp.net中創建lostfocus事件?
- 28. 有沒有辦法在Symfony2中創建區域依賴路由
- 29. 有沒有辦法在java中循環動態創建組件?
- 30. 有沒有辦法在Bash腳本中創建鍵值對?
我只想編寫和測試一些javascript功能,然後我可以在Chrome中使用哪種編輯器來創建和運行這些.js文件? – chaohuang 2012-03-16 04:48:36
有Chrome開發者控制檯,但它不是代碼編輯器。你會使用一個真正的編輯器。 – 2012-03-16 04:50:13
CTRL + SHIFT + J將打開chrome開發工具,單擊控制檯選項卡並測試。順便說一句,在Firebug firefox插件中可用 – dbrin 2012-03-16 04:51:58